Brewed in conjunction with The Aviary and Fountainhead, this brew takes the old German gose and stands it on its head. A radical nose of charred red peppers, tart lime, and a briny tang give only a glimpse of what lies ahead. On the tongue, the citrus acidity buffers against the bite of smoked peppers, while a toasted cracker malt that is reminiscent of a wood fired pizza crust peeks through somewhat timidly. Finally, the sour lime and salt dig in through the finish. Leave it up to the crew from AtG to brew this crazy ass beer that I couldn't put down. Bonus points for the killer label art!
